問題タブ [vimdiff]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
5 に答える
3086 参照

vim - 複数のバッファへのdiffput?

を使用して 3 つのファイルを編集しているときvimdiffに、1 つのファイルから他の 2 つのファイルの両方にハンクをコピーしたい場合があります。通常、これは次のように実行されます。

ただし、次のように:help diffput述べています。

bufspecこれは、複数のバッファーを指定できるかどうかに興味があります。ドキュメントを使用してみましたが、推測しましたが、うまくいきませんでした。

コマンドで複数のバッファを指定することはできますdiffputか?

0 投票する
1 に答える
915 参照

windows - Windows で Git から Vimdiff を使用すると、色が浮き上がる

Windows マシンで Vimdiff を差分/マージ ツールとして使用するように Git を構成しました。動作しますが、色がめちゃくちゃです。まず、構文をオンにしてファイルタイプを設定するようにいくら指示しても、構文の強調表示は表示されません。第二に、colorscheme は不快ですが、:colorscheme-CTRLD押しても、通常の colorchemes のリストが表示されません。デフォルトのものはなく、自分でインストールしたものだけです。

奇妙なことに、私のカラースキームは問題なく、予想されるすべてのカラースキームが利用可能であり、Git ではなくコマンドプロンプトから直接 Vim を起動すると、構文の強調表示が機能します。

これにより、変更を確認するのが不必要に苦痛になり、同僚に差分を見せようとしているときは特に面倒です。それらはほとんど読めません。これは何ヶ月も私を悩ませてきました、そして私はそれを理解することができません.

Git で Vim を起動するのと、Vim を起動するだけで何か違うことはありますか? これを修正して、Vim が一貫して動作するようにするにはどうすればよいですか?

0 投票する
1 に答える
192 参照

vim - vimdiff を使用する場合、変更のブロックの下部を見つけるにはどうすればよいですか

vimdiff を使用していると、変更の先頭行だけでなく、変更を選択したい場合があります。私がやっていることは、カーソルを変更の一番下に手動で配置してから、マクロを使用することです

マクロを拡張して、次の行に沿ってさらに何かをしたいと思います アドバイスや関連情報 (つまり diff 固有のアドレス) をいただければ幸いです。ありがとう

0 投票する
1 に答える
80 参照

macos - Mac を 10.9.2 にアップグレードした後、結合ツールとしての vim が壊れました

Mac を 10.9.2 にアップグレードしたところ、突然、vim が

オプションは不明です。しかし、私は~/.gitconfig、オプションが存在し、常に機能する my を変更していません。

これは、それを修正するために何かをアップグレードまたはインストールする必要があるということですか?

0 投票する
1 に答える
290 参照

bash - Vimdiff メッセージの抑制

私はオンラインで調べてみましたが、誰もそれに対する簡単な答えを持っていないようです.

私の bash スクリプトでは、2 つのファイルに対して vimdiff を使用していますが、vimdiff を閉じると、ファイルが異なる場合は常に「編集する 2 つのファイル」と表示されます。 誰もこれに対する解決策を持っていないようです .vimrc編集ではなく、私のbashスクリプトにそのメッセージを抑制する簡単な方法があるかどうか疑問に思っていました.

0 投票する
1 に答える
2930 参照

vim - vimdiff 構文の強調表示を改善する

実行するvimdiffと、かなり悪い構文の強調表示が表示されます (判読不能):

ここに画像の説明を入力

MacVim での実行は少し改善されましたが、それでもひどいものです。

これは私のカラースキーム (現在はトゥモローナイトを使用) によるものですか?

vimdiffもしそうなら、テーマの外側で使用されている色を変更する方法はありますか、またはftpluginこれをより適切にサポートする別の色をインストールする方法はありますか (これについてset filetypeは、vim代わりにdiffまたは同様に表示されているかどうかはわかりません)。